A lot of Sydney house owners think about ceiling fan installation just when the heat becomes unbearable, which seriousness typically causes hurried decisions that cost more to fix later. What hardly ever gets gone over is the relationship between ceiling fan installation and the overall electrical layout of a home. Every home has a switchboard with a limited number of circuits, and adding a new fan-- particularly one with a different light package and remote control receiver-- implies comprehending where that fan will draw its power from and whether the existing circuit can deal with the additional load. Making the effort to analyze these electrical fundamentals before acquiring anything is what separates a smooth installation from one that ends in a callback to the electrician.
The ceiling fan installation market has actually evolved significantly, and Sydney property owners now have access to DC motor fans that take in a fraction of the energy that older air conditioning motor models needed. A quality DC fan can operate on as low as a few watts on its lowest setting, making it far cheaper to run over a long, warm season. Nevertheless, DC fans and those fitted with push-button control receivers need cautious circuitry during installation since the receiver system need to be housed correctly inside the canopy, and the connections should be made in the right sequence. This is not uncertainty-- it requires checking out the wiring diagram specific to that model and having a certified electrician carry out the live connections. Skipping that step is where lots of ceiling fan installation tasks go wrong, leading to fans that hum, flicker their lights, or stop working to react to remote commands.
Blade pitch is another technical factor that shapes the success of a ceiling fan installation yet rarely appears in the showroom conversation. Blade pitch describes the angle at which the blades are set relative to horizontal, normally in between twelve and fifteen degrees on a properly designed fan. Too flat, and the blades press little air despite speed. Too steep, and the motor strains under the load, creating heat and minimizing the lifespan of the unit. In Australia, trusted fan brands engineer the blade pitch to fit regional conditions, accounting for the sort of ceiling heights and space volumes common in residential construction across Sydney and wider New South Wales. Verifying this requirements before purchase ensures the fan will actually perform as expected once the ceiling fan installation is total.
Noise is among the most typical problems raised after a ceiling fan installation, and it usually traces back to among 3 causes: a mounting box that has worked loose, blades that are out of balance, or a motor housing that was not seated level during assembly. Checking the installing box for any motion before connecting the fan is worth the extra couple of minutes, as is using a small level throughout the motor housing once it is hung. Blade balance can be inspected by marking each blade and running the fan at its highest setting to identify which one is causing the wobble. The majority of quality fans consist of a balancing package for exactly this function, and using it systematically will get rid of the problem without requiring any disassembly of the ceiling fan installation.
Location-specific thinking matters more than the majority of people understand when planning a ceiling fan installation in Sydney. Homes near the coast are exposed to higher salt air concentrations, which can accelerate rust on fan components not ranked for those conditions. Covered outdoor locations such as alfresco areas and verandahs likewise need read more fans specifically ranked for outside or damp usage-- basic indoor fans will deteriorate quickly in those environments. Analyzing where the fan will live, what it will be exposed to, and how it links into the home's electrical system from the very start is what makes ceiling fan installation a really beneficial and long lasting financial investment.
